Illuminance

Illuminance simulations are used to determine light levels in units of Lux or foot-candles, Daylight Factor or Sky Factor. Simulations can be performed using the following options:

If IES’s LEED v4 Navigator is used, it will automate the illuminance simulations at 9am and 3pm on a clear-sky day at the equinox for each regularly occupied space. The four results are then averaged as required to demonstrate illuminance levels are between 300 lux and 3,000 lux (28 ft.cd – 279 ft.cd) for compliance with LEED Indoor Environmental Quality (IEQ) Daylight (Option 2).
